How Reliable is the Volvo XC90?
Based on 1,122,947 MOT tests across 82,375 vehicles.

M222 RCO is a 2012 Volvo XC90 in Black with a 2,401c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 44 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 68.2%.
Across all 2012 Volvo XC90 models, the average MOT pass rate is 79.2% with a typical mileage of 79,964 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Volvo XC90 f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 23,030 recorded failures. If you're considering buying M222 RCO,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Volvo XC90 typically stays on UK roads for around 23 years. At 14 years old, this Volvo XC90 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
